Answer:
y = x² − 6x − 27
Step-by-step explanation:
To distribute, you can use something called FOIL. It stands for First, Outer, Inner, Last.
First, multiply the First term in each factor.
x · x = x²
Now multiply the Outer terms in each factor.
x · 3 = 3x
Next multiply the Inner terms in each factor.
-9 · x = -9x
Finally, multiply the Last terms in each factor.
-9 · 3 = -27
Add them all up:
x² + 3x − 9x − 27
x² − 6x − 27

In y = mx + b form, the slope can be found in the m position and the y intercept can be found in the b position.
y = mx + b
y = 2x + 15
slope(m) = 2 and y int (b) = 15
The initial amount is the y intercept, which is 15. The rate of change (the slope) is 2
example :
baskets picked in 1 hr :
y = 2(1) + 15
y = 2 + 15
y = 17
baskets picked in 2 hrs :
y = 2(2) + 15
y = 4 + 15
y = 19
so the slope ( rate of change) is basically saying for every hr of picking, you pick 2 baskets...so your picking 2 baskets per hr.
The y intercept (15) is telling us that they already had 15 baskets to start with.
